AI-Powered Robots
Artificial intelligence allows robots to go beyond programmed tasks:
-
Analytical AI – Analyses machine data to predict maintenance needs and reduce downtime.
-
Generative AI – Generates solutions, simulates workflows, and communicates with workers.
-
Agentic AI – Combines analytical and generative AI, allowing robots to make independent decisions and manage tasks autonomously.
These robots can adapt to new situations, operate independently, and assist humans without constant supervision.

Collaborative Robots (Cobots) & Digital Twins
- Cobots – Work safely alongside humans, enhancing productivity without compromising safety.
- Digital Twins – Virtual replicas of factory processes that allow simulation and optimisation before real-world implementation.
This combination reduces downtime, optimises workflows, and saves time and resources.
Workforce Transformation
Advanced robotics is reshaping the workforce. Robots handle repetitive, data-heavy tasks, allowing humans to focus on creativity, supervision, and problem-solving.
Role Evolution in 2026:
| Traditional Role | New Role |
|---|---|
| Assembly Line Worker | Robot Supervisor |
| Machine Operator | Automation Technician |
| Quality Inspector | Quality Data Analyst |
| Warehouse Picker | Mobile Robot Manager |

Automation & Smart Factories
Automation, AI, and edge computing make factories smarter and more efficient.
Key Technologies:
- Predictive Maintenance: AI predicts equipment failures, reducing downtime and repair costs.
- Edge computing: Enables faster decision-making directly on the factory floor.
- Digital Twins: Allow virtual testing of production processes before implementation.
These technologies accelerate production cycles, reduce errors, and increase operational efficiency.
